Palatal Expanders

A palate expander, also known as a palatal expander, is a device used to widen the roof of your mouth. At Orthodontic Associates, we use palate expanders typically in children to correct posterior crossbites and to reduce crowding to make more room for their teeth. Wearing a palate expander can also help open airways and make space for unerupted teeth, like the upper canines, to prevent tooth impactions. Impacted teeth are unable to fully erupt into their proper position in your smile due to lack of space.

Types of Palate Expanders

From the makers of Invisalign clear aligners! The Invisalign® Palatal Expander System makes room for adult teeth in kids ages 6-11 using a series of 3D-printed expanders that gradually widen to create space for adult teeth.

Metal expanders are bonded to the teeth using printed metal technology instead of using the traditional more uncomfortable bands.

At Orthodontic Associates, we use 3D printed metal technology to create a truly custom appliance—which offers benefits to both the orthodontic team and patients. The flexibility in custom digital design provides greater treatment efficiency and ensures a precise fit. Unlike traditional metal bands where separators are often required, 3D metal printing saves valuable chair time, eliminates the discomfort of separators, and provides a better patient experience.

What’s phase I orthodontic treatment? 
Phase 1 treatment (braces or Invisalign) is for kids who are still in the early stages of having a mix of baby and adult teeth. This usually occurs between age 6-9. The goal of phase I treatment is to develop kid’s jaws and/or teeth to make room for existing teeth and incoming permanent teeth. 🦷

How often are my orthodontic appointments?
Join Dr. Amy and Dr. Theobald as they discuss how often your smile progress needs to be checked during braces or Invisalign treatment! 
💙 For braces, we will need to see you every 6-8 weeks. 
💙 For Invisalign treatment, we will need to see you about every 12 weeks.
